Gerard "Jerry"'s Obituary

Gerard “Jerry” Carpinello Jr., 49, of Portland, PA, passed away Friday, July 29, 2022, at Jersey Shore University Medical Center in Neptune, NJ. He was surrounded by his family and friends.Jerry was born in Brooklyn, NY on October 9, 1972 to Gerard Carpinello Sr. and Sharon Maynard....
